9/24/17 - Home-1st: 4.53, Position Velocity:  80, Exit Velocity: 89
6-foot-1, 175-pound, RHH showed that he has all 5 tools, ranking in the top half of the leaderboard in every category.  Medium, athletic body w/ projectable lower half.  Hits from a slightly open, slightly crouched stance w/ back shoulder hand location.  Leg kick to slightly open w/ proper load.  Generates bat speed w/ all fields approach.  Projects for power w/ present gap to gap power playing, went 1-4 in game w/ double to left field.  Average runner is better underway.  Defensively, shows solid actions, w/ reliable hands and feet.  Ball gets in a little deep on him, can do a better job of fielding ball out in front.  Very intriguing uncommitted prospect that should be getting looks for a team needing to fill some middle infield depth to finish out their class.

9/4/16 - Home-1st: 4.71, Position Velocity:  IF-72, Exit Velocity: 87
6-foot-0, 175-pound, RHH hits from a taller and balanced stance, hands seem relaxed at the start, uses a pretty generic stride and a slight push back with his hands to get loaded, seems to tense up slightly in his load, lower half initially fires but doesn’t get all the way through to allow his hips to totally clear, bat path is shorter and steeper at the beginning but flattens out and stays there, strong kid was able to get through a few balls to LCF in BP.  Defensively, gets around the ball well and tries to play through it, fields the ball a little deep on occasion, a glove pat in the middle of his exchange causes it to be longer but leads to a short arm action through a high ¾ release with average arm strength across the infield.
